Phil Spear Shoveling Snow, February 1956

Phil Spear Shoveling Snow, February 1956 image
Year:
1956
Published In:
Ann Arbor News, February 17, 1956
Caption:
CURBSIDE RESCUE: Many Ann Arbor motorists whose cars were parked at the curb during last night's snowstorm found themselves in the plight of this driver, Mrs. Patricia Williams of 612 Woodmere Pl. A snowplow had jammed snow against the side and underneath her car as it was parked on S. University Ave., preventing the vehicle from moving. However, Phil Spear of 1315 S. State St. brings his shovel into play and frees the imprisoned auto.

Car Hit By Train, William St. and Ann Arbor Railroad Tracks, October 1940

Car Hit By Train, William St. and Ann Arbor Railroad Tracks, October 1940 image
Year:
1940
Published In:
Ann Arbor News, October 19, 1940
Caption:
SCENE OF FATAL CROSSING ACCIDENT: Joel S. Culp, 69-year-old carpenter, of Platt subdivision, met death in the wreckage of the car pictured above when it was hit by an Ann Arbor railroad train at the W. William St. crossing yesterday afternoon. It was the third fatal traffic accident here this year and the first railroad crossing fatality here in nine years. (Story on page 1).

Car in Snowstorm, Intersection of Main & Liberty Sts., March 1947

Car in Snowstorm, Intersection of Main & Liberty Sts., March 1947 image
Year:
1947
Published In:
Ann Arbor News, March 25, 1947
Caption:
KEEPING WINDOWS CLEAR KEEPS MOTORISTS BUSY: Ann Arbor drivers had to go it blind now and then as wind-driven snow cluttered car windows and obscured vision. This picture was taken at Main and Liberty Sts.

Snow-Loader At Work On Main Street, March 1947

Snow-Loader At Work On Main Street, March 1947 image
Year:
1947
Published In:
Ann Arbor News, March 25, 1947
Caption:
PLENTY OF WORK FOR THIS OUTFIT TODAY: Ann Arbor's snow-loader found plenty of fuel for its hungry maw today as city workers faced overtime labors trying to dig out of the worst March storm in many years. This picture was made at Main and William Sts.

Car Stuck in Snowstorm, March 1947

Car Stuck in Snowstorm, March 1947 image
Year:
1947
Published In:
Ann Arbor News, March 25, 1947
Caption:
DRIVER OF THIS CAR WAS NOT ALONE IN HIS PLIGHT: Well stuck on Berkley St. at Main St. is this car and the efforts of those two pushers didn't prove sufficient by a long way. The scene was repeated many times over this morning as drivers went a little way, slid into the rough and decided to walk to work.
